Statue in ND prayer garden destroyed, motive for attack unknown

2018-08-04 Statue damaged

FARGO – A congregation in Fargo, North Dakota is praying for the vandal or vandals who destroyed a statue on church property.  Someone this week destroyed a statue of the Virgin Mary at St. Anthony of Padua Catholic Church.  The damage was discovered on Aug 1.

The statue stood in a prayer garden at the church according to a report from KVRR. It was a memorial erected by a parishioner about two years ago in memory of her husband, according to WDAY television.

Father Raymond Courtright told KFGO television his parish community views what happened to the statue as an opportunity for prayer and forgiveness.

Police have not determined a motive for the crime. Anyone with information about the criminal or criminals responsible for the vandalism is asked to call the Fargo Police Department at 701-235-4493.
